Transaction e176e348c3069abcf9cb84802af17c1a83a5d6df06aec37295606d242bf75176
1 Input
1 Output
-
e176e348c3069abcf9cb84802af17c1a83a5d6df06aec37295606d242bf75176:0
- value
- 25833217
- script pubkey
- OP_0 OP_PUSHBYTES_20 39fdd776fabab49b2d8b3675d839c5c44cefe6c5
- address
- bc1q887awah6h26fktvtxe6asww9c3xwlek9dhnyz8